Ticket: Config drift on BloomShield

The bloom filter fronting KegStore has drifted between nodes. Node pool B still runs the old false-positive target, so cache-miss rates differ across the Orrindale cluster and metrics look noisy. Root cause: manual edits during the March incident were never backported to the template. Fix: re-render from the template and redeploy all nodes. The canonical values are as follows.

service settings:
PRAIX_LOG_LEVEL=error
PRAIX_METRICS_HOST=metrics.praix.qorvelcorp.corp
PRAIX_POOL_SIZE=16

**Action item:** finish sharding the Pebblenook profile store. Support folks — while the resharding job runs, profile edits may lag a minute or two; that's expected, don't escalate unless it passes five. Point angry tickets at the status page macro. The shard-count and batch settings we landed on are below.

constants for bawif-kawif:
QUOTAS = {
    "ulaael": 5,
    "holael": 10,
}

**Onboarding: Log sampling for the Murmurly notifier**

The Murmurly notification service emits roughly two million log lines per hour, so we sample aggressively: errors are kept at 100%, warnings at 25%, and info lines at 1%, with a keep-all override for any request flagged by the fraud pipeline. For your security review, note that sampling rules live in a sealed config bundle; auditors who need the raw, unsampled firehose must unseal it first. Unsealing requires the recovery passphrase recorded directly below this paragraph.

strongbox words: briiel-zoreth-noveth-pelys-druwyn-feniel-lamvan-ulaius-kasion